From: Intravenous superoxide dismutase as a protective agent to prevent impairment of lung function induced by high tidal volume ventilation

Hourly measured serum NO during LTV (white) and HTV ventilation (black) and HTV ventilation with SOD administration (grey). Both LTV and HTV ventilation decreased serum NO. LTV ventilation decreased serum NO primarily during the first 2 h of ventilation (P < 0.05), whereas HTV ventilation decreased serum NO throughout most of the 5 h of ventilation (P < 0.05, except at 4 h). Notably, SOD administration monotonically increased serum NO level during the course of HTV ventilation
